pith. sign in

arxiv: 2111.01777 · v2 · pith:T7VKWFXMnew · submitted 2021-11-02 · 💻 cs.RO · cs.LG· cs.MA· cs.SY· eess.SY

A Framework for Real-World Multi-Robot Systems Running Decentralized GNN-Based Policies

classification 💻 cs.RO cs.LGcs.MAcs.SYeess.SY
keywords gnn-basedpoliciesdecentralizedframeworkhttpsmulti-robotreal-worldagent
0
0 comments X
read the original abstract

GNNs are a paradigm-shifting neural architecture to facilitate the learning of complex multi-agent behaviors. Recent work has demonstrated remarkable performance in tasks such as flocking, multi-agent path planning and cooperative coverage. However, the policies derived through GNN-based learning schemes have not yet been deployed to the real-world on physical multi-robot systems. In this work, we present the design of a system that allows for fully decentralized execution of GNN-based policies. We create a framework based on ROS2 and elaborate its details in this paper. We demonstrate our framework on a case-study that requires tight coordination between robots, and present first-of-a-kind results that show successful real-world deployment of GNN-based policies on a decentralized multi-robot system relying on Adhoc communication. A video demonstration of this case-study, as well as the accompanying source code repository, can be found online. https://www.youtube.com/watch?v=COh-WLn4iO4 https://github.com/proroklab/ros2_multi_agent_passage https://github.com/proroklab/rl_multi_agent_passage

This paper has not been read by Pith yet.

discussion (0)

Sign in with ORCID, Apple, or X to comment. Anyone can read and Pith papers without signing in.